Breeze 1.2.2 – Une version mineure
Publié: 2021-06-22
Breeze 1.2.2 est sorti, et c'est une version mineure principalement axée sur l'importation/exportation de configurations de brise à partir de l'interface graphique du plugin et de la CLI WP. Si vous exécutez plusieurs sites WordPress, la gestion des configurations Breeze pour tous les sites Web peut être fastidieuse, et le réglage manuel des mêmes paramètres peut également être une tâche fastidieuse.
Par conséquent, Breeze est désormais livré avec une solution qui vous aide à gérer vos paramètres de cache répétitifs pour plusieurs sites Web directement à partir de WP CLI et de l'interface graphique. Vous pouvez même gérer les configurations d'un multisite WordPress qui vous fait gagner beaucoup de temps.
Remarque : Quoi de neuf dans Breeze 1.2.2
Alors, sans plus tarder, examinons brièvement les nouvelles fonctionnalités intéressantes que Breeze apporte dans cette version, mais d'abord, vérifions l'onglet d'importation et d'exportation visuel disponible dans les paramètres du plugin.
Onglet Paramètre Breeze (Importer/Exporter)
Une fois le plugin mis à jour, vous verrez un nouvel onglet d' importation/exportation de paramètres dans les paramètres. Il est basé sur une interface graphique et il vous suffit de quelques clics pour importer ou exporter la configuration.

Ce qui suit sont mes paramètres d' options avancées actuels, et je vais démontrer le processus en exportant d'abord ces paramètres, puis en les modifiant, et enfin en important le fichier JSON exporté pour montrer comment cela fonctionne.

Maintenant, tout ce que vous avez à faire est de cliquer sur Exporter JSON , qui télécharge un fichier JSON contenant les paramètres Breeze actuels de votre site.

Ensuite, modifiez les paramètres Breeze et cliquez sur Enregistrer les modifications . Comme vous pouvez le voir dans l'image ci-dessous, j'ai décoché toutes les fonctions sauf Lazy-Load Images .

Les paramètres Breeze actuels contiennent différentes configurations, testons donc la fonction d'importation en important le fichier JSON (exporté précédemment).
Remarque : Maintenant, cliquez sur Sélectionner un fichier JSON et choisissez le fichier JSON, puis cliquez sur Importer un fichier . Une notification de rechargement de page apparaîtra où vous devrez cliquer sur OK pour recharger, et tous les paramètres importés seront appliqués.

Une fois les paramètres importés avec succès, vérifiez vos configurations Breeze. Dans mon cas, les paramètres initiaux ont été importés avec succès et contiennent les mêmes paramètres que j'ai utilisés initialement.
De cette façon, vous pouvez facilement utiliser les mêmes paramètres spécifiques pour de nombreuses applications. Par exemple, si vous exécutez plusieurs sites LMS et optimisez les paramètres de cache pour l'un de vos sites, vous pouvez appliquer les mêmes configurations à tous les sites en quelques clics.
Breeze prend en charge WP CLI
Si vous êtes à l'aise avec les commandes CLI, cette fonctionnalité est spécialement pour vous. Outre la fonctionnalité d'interface graphique du plugin, vous pouvez également gérer la fonction d'importation/exportation directement à partir de la commande WP CLI.
Dans Cloudways, vous pouvez utiliser directement la WP CLI directement depuis le serveur SSH Terminal où vous devez fournir les informations d'identification d'accès au serveur. Voici un guide qui vous aidera à comprendre comment utiliser WP CLI.
Breeze a une commande de base " wp brise " que vous pouvez utiliser pour les fonctions d' exportation ou d' importation . Si vous souhaitez vérifier les détails, exécutez simplement la commande wp brise help .


Alors, vérifions d'abord la fonction d'exportation.
Exportation – WP CLI
L'exportation du paramètre Breeze est simple et il vous suffit d'exécuter la commande suivante.
wp breeze export

Le fichier JSON sera téléchargé dans le dossier wp-content/uploads/breeze-export . C'est l'emplacement par défaut, mais vous pouvez fournir un chemin de fichier différent si vous souhaitez le télécharger dans un autre dossier.
Voici la commande si vous souhaitez la télécharger dans un dossier spécifique, et dans mon cas, je l'enregistrerai dans le dossier de téléchargement .
Si vous utilisez WordPress multisite et que vous souhaitez gérer la fonction d'exportation, il est légèrement différent de définir le paramètre site –level .
Pour le réseau : Les paramètres au niveau du réseau reflètent

( and so on) will export the settings for the site with that respective ID . Pour le site 1 ou le site 2 ou ainsi de suite : (et ainsi de suite) exportera les paramètres du site avec cet ID respectif.
wp breeze export --level=1


Comme mentionné précédemment, l'emplacement du fichier par défaut est le même dossier « wp-content/uploads/breeze-export ». Si vous souhaitez modifier l'emplacement, vous pouvez définir le chemin d'emplacement du fichier pour WordPress multisite.
wp breeze export --level=2 --file-path=/home/419414.cloudwaysapps.com/hnruaxrptg/public_html/wp-content/uploads/

Importation - WP CLI
La fonction d'importation est très puissante car vous pouvez importer le fichier JSON depuis votre serveur et des adresses URL valides à distance .
Dans la fonction d' importation , il est nécessaire de définir le chemin du fichier JSON. Lorsque le fichier a été importé avec succès, le fichier brise-config.php sera actualisé. Maintenant, modifions vos paramètres de brise et importons le fichier JSON que nous avons précédemment exporté dans le dossier de téléchargement .
wp brise import –file-path=<chemin d'accès au fichier JSON>.
wp breeze import --file-path=/home/master/applications/rkhpgjjhas/public_html/wp-content/uploads/breeze-export-settings--11-06-2021.json

Si vous souhaitez importer les paramètres Breeze à partir d'une URL distante, vous pouvez utiliser la commande suivante :
wp breeze import --file-path=https://wordpress-571835-1981468.cloudwaysapps.com/example.json

Pour les paramètres d'import de WordPress multisite, vous devez définir le niveau de votre site.
wp brise import –file-path=<chemin du fichier JSON> –level=network/ID
wp breeze import --file-path=--file-path=/home/419414.cloudwaysapps.com/hnruaxrptg/public_html/wp-content/uploads/breeze-export-settings--11-06-2021.json --level=2

Enveloppez-le !
L'équipe Cloudways travaille sans relâche pour faire de Breeze votre plug-in de cache de prédilection. J'espère que cette nouvelle fonctionnalité vous plaira car elle vous fera gagner beaucoup de temps. Si vous avez des questions ou des commentaires sur Breeze 1.2.2, faites-le nous savoir dans la section commentaires ci-dessous !
Cloudways parraine WP-CLI, et nous travaillerons bientôt plus autour de WP-CLI.
